Is Shadow Creek Safe?
Shadow Creek in Edmond, OK has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 27, which is 73%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Edmond average (crime index 40), Shadow Creek is 13%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 130, 30%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 3). Violent crime is a particular area of concern relative to property crime in this neighborhood.
Overall, Shadow Creek is considered a safe neighborhood for residents and visitors. Standard urban awareness is recommended, but the area benefits from lower-than-average crime rates across most categories.
